INSPECTED THIS MORNlNG.—Members of the Auckland City Council inspected the beach at Kohimarama this morning to examine how far the proposed new road would encroach upon it. It was decided to construct the road 76 yards farther back on the beach. The pictures show, top: A line of people marking the site of the original proposed route. Lower: Members of the council examining plans of the locality.
